Description
"The day Emma Heming Willis' husband, Bruce Willis, was diagnosed with frontotemporal dementia (FTD), all they were given was a pamphlet and told to check back in a few months. That's it. With no hope or direction, Emma walked out of that appointment frozen with fear, confusion, and a sense that her world had just fallen apart. In fact, it had. Bruce and Emma had their story written, their future mapped out. Yet all those dreams crumbled with that diagnosis, and Emma felt more alone than ever. How would she care for her husband while parenting their young daughters? At that devastating time, Emma just wanted someone who'd been through it to tell her, "This feels terrible. Your life is in shambles. But it's going to be okay. Here are some things to put in place so you can not just survive but thrive." With The Unexpected Journey, Emma has written the book she wishes she'd been handed on that day: a supportive, practical guide to navigating the complicated, emotional, and transformative experience that is caregiving. Weaving her personal journey with the latest research and insights from the world's top dementia, caregiving, and integrative experts, she offers the guidance and wisdom caregivers everywhere so desperately need and deserve. Ultimately, The Unexpected Journey shows you how to care for yourself while doing one of the hardest, most heartbreaking jobs in the world. It's not selfish; it's self-preserving. Because if you don't take care of yourself, you won't be able to care for anyone else. For care partners of individuals with any form of dementia or even other conditions, The Unexpected Journey shows that you're not alone and your emotions are valid"--
